Transaction 12389aff7d16e334a0f3ead47958574901149508de40aeaad7bc5874610999bd

1 Input
2 Outputs
  • 12389aff7d16e334a0f3ead47958574901149508de40aeaad7bc5874610999bd:0
  • value  35973
    address  39Ln8hbsAkQJvYEngmD2UenVvJWnK7cftW
  • 12389aff7d16e334a0f3ead47958574901149508de40aeaad7bc5874610999bd:1
  • value  39731
    address  1LQjP7yPFy8dvT32A3r4XC2CTBHMd43FeT